Why Choose a Trusted Window Installer?
Selecting the right window installation contractor is essential for numerous reasons:

Quality of Work: A trusted installer has the experience and skills required to make sure that windows are set up correctly, which straight impacts their performance and longevity.

Security Concerns: Improper installation can cause safety concerns, making it important to engage specialists who stick to market standards.

Energy Efficiency: The proper installation of windows can considerably affect a home's energy intake. Badly set up windows can result in air leaks, which can increase energy expenses.

Service warranties and Guarantees: Trusted installers typically provide warranties for both their work and the windows themselves, offering assurance for property owners.

Compliance with Building Codes: A professional installer understands and follows local building regulations, ensuring that your installation is legal and safe.

How do I know if I need brand-new windows?
Signs that you might require new windows consist of drafts, condensation in between panes, difficulty opening or closing windows, and visible changes in your energy costs.
2. What kinds of windows should I select?
Choosing window types depends upon personal choice, energy performance objectives, and the architectural style of your home. Typical types include double-hung, moving, Casement Window Installation, and bay windows.
3. How long does window installation take?
The installation time can differ based upon several factors, including the number of windows being changed and any required repairs. Typically, it can take anywhere from a couple of hours to a couple of days.
4. What can I do to get ready for window installation?
To prepare for window installation, clear the area around the windows of furniture and designs, and ensure the installers have easy access to the needed work spaces.
